KATHMANDU, Oct 31: Now international chartered flights will take off and land at the newly-constructed Gautam Buddha International Airport (GBIA) in Bhairahawa, the Civil Aviation Authority of Nepal (CAAN) decided. Earlier, all international chartered flights took place at the Tribhuvan International Airport (TIA).

POKHARA, March 29: The District Administration Office of Mustang district sent 58 foreign tourists to Kathmandu on Saturday. But 10 foreign tourists who came in contact with the government officials in the district declined to go back to Kathmandu. They are currently staying in hotels in the district.

KATHMANDU, March 17: Among the total 49 airports in the country, 19 do not operate regular flight services. With airports stagnant, airfields have transformed into grass fields.
